MBIA Inc. reported a Q1 2026 EPS of -$0.84, falling well short of the consensus estimate of -$0.1566 (a negative surprise of 436.4%). Revenue was not disclosed for the quarter. The stock declined by 2.86% in the regular session following the release, reflecting investor disappointment with the magnitude of the loss.

While the company did not report specific revenue figures, the earnings miss points to elevated loss provisions or adverse claims development within its insured portfolio. As a financial guarantor, MBIA’s income statement is highly sensitive to changes in the credit performance of its insured bonds, particularly in the municipal and structured finance segments. During the quarter, the company may have recorded mark‑to‑market losses on derivative contracts or incurred higher loss expenses related to legacy exposures. Operating expenses likely remained elevated as MBIA continues to manage its in‑runoff insurance book. The reported net loss of $0.84 per share contrasts sharply with the consensus estimate and suggests that the credit environment or specific insured credits deteriorated more than anticipated. MBIA’s management did not provide forward guidance in the earnings release, a common practice given the company’s run‑off status. However, the sharp earnings miss may prompt analysts to revise their models downward for upcoming quarters. The company continues to face legacy litigation and regulatory overhangs, which could require further litigation reserves. In addition, the potential for elevated credit losses in certain municipal sectors (e.g., toll roads, healthcare) remains a risk factor. Management may emphasize capital preservation and the gradual reduction of insured liabilities. The lack of revenue visibility makes it difficult to assess top‑line trends, and the focus remains on cash flow generation from the in‑force book. The company’s strategic priority appears to remain the orderly run‑off of its insurance operations while seeking to maximise recoveries from its investment portfolio. The stock’s 2.86% decline in the session following the report indicates that the market viewed the large loss negatively, though the move was relatively contained given the magnitude of the surprise. Analysts may downgrade their earnings estimates or lower price targets due to the unexpected loss. The lack of revenue disclosure limits the ability to gauge underlying business momentum, making it difficult to identify a clear catalyst for a turnaround. Key items to watch in the coming quarters include: the size of net claims paid, changes in the loss reserve position, and any updates on legacy litigation. The company’s book value per share, which is a key metric for financial guarantors, may have declined significantly in Q1. For now, MBIA remains a high‑risk, low‑visibility name that may only appeal to deep‑value or distressed‑specialist investors. The next earnings release will be crucial to confirm whether the Q1 loss was a one‑time event or the start of a trend.
